Copy of message I just sent to seller:
Just FYI... these plants really don't do well with hamburger. They really don't need to be fed at all. If they are put outside they seem to attract and catch appropriate food on their own. Probably the best advice you could give is to water with rain, distilled, or reverse osmosis water... not tap, well or spring water.

here is what I wrote ( second message )

Hello,

I am sorry to bother you. I wrote you some time ago about selling Venus flytraps on Ebay and the care information that you supplied.

I wanted to ask if I may, where/who told you that this is proper care for these plants?

Certain doom for the plants you are offering will take place if those directions are followed. These plants actually need to sit in a dish of water 1 to 1 1/2 inches. But not much more than that.

Sunny windows are good depending on where you live in the world. In many places the sun is too strong and indirect lighting and or supplemental fluorescent lighting works better.

I am by no means trying to start anything. My main concern is for the well being of these plants and for the people that purchase them. All I want is for people to be happy with these plants and to help keep them around for generations to come.

Many people feel that these are hard tropical plants to take care of.

That is not the case, but the problem lies with the disinformation that has been spreading around since the beginning of time with carnivorous plants.

I ask that you reconsider your care information and/or source of information and pass along to your buyers the correct way to take care of these plants.
